This book, a renowned text on constitutional law, introduces readers to the essential principles of the British constitution. Despite its title, the book is less concerned with providing an outline of constitutional law, but rather explores the legal guidelines which shape the modern British constitution. The author, a renowned expert on constitutional law, draws comparisons between constitutional systems including those in the UK, United States, and France. This comparative approach provides readers with a broader perspective on the British constitution. The book's main themes revolve around the tensions between sovereignty of Parliament, the rule of law, and the complex relationship between law and convention within the British constitution. The author argues that understanding these tensions lies at the heart of comprehending the UK constitution.
